Death toll from blast at explosives factory in Russia rises to 20
Updated: Aug 19th, 2025 The death toll from a blast that took place on Friday at an explosives factory in Russia’s Ryazan has increased to 20 while 134 others have been injured in the incident, emergency officials said on Monday. Australian Court Fines Qantas $59 Million for Illegal Layoffs of 1,800 Workers
An Australian court has fined Qantas Aus$90 million (US$59 million) for illegally dismissing 1,800 ground staff during the Covid-19 pandemic, concluding a five-year legal battle over workers’ rights.
